mrm_BridgeOpening

tables.auto_generated.mrm_BridgeOpening

Classes

Name Description
mrm_BridgeOpeningTable Table for mrm_BridgeOpening (mrm_BridgeOpening).
mrm_BridgeOpeningTableColumns Column names for mrm_BridgeOpening (mrm_BridgeOpening).

mrm_BridgeOpeningTable

t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able(net_table)

Table for mrm_BridgeOpening (mrm_BridgeOpening).

Attributes

Name Description
columns Get the columns for the table.
description Get the table description.
display_name Get the display name for the table.
name Get the table name.

Methods

Name Description
delete Create a DELETE query for this table.
get_muids Get a list of MUIDs for the table.
insert Insert a row with the given values.
select Create a SELECT query for this table.
update Create an UPDATE query for this table.
delete
t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able.delete()

Create a DELETE query for this table.

Returns
Name Type Description
DeleteQuery A new DeleteQuery object
get_muids
t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able.get_muids(
    order_by=None,
    descending=False,
)

Get a list of MUIDs for the table.

Parameters
Name Type Description Default
order_by str or None Column to order the MUIDs by None
descending bool Whether to order in descending order False
Returns
Name Type Description
list of str A list of MUIDs
insert
t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able.insert(
    values,
    execute=True,
)

Insert a row with the given values.

Parameters
Name Type Description Default
values dict of str to Any Column-value pairs to insert required
execute bool Whether to execute the query immediately (default: True) True
Returns
Name Type Description
str or InsertQuery If execute is True, returns the ID of the newly inserted row (MUID) If execute is False, returns an InsertQuery instance
select
t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able.select(
    columns=[],
)

Create a SELECT query for this table.

Parameters
Name Type Description Default
columns list of str The columns to select []
Returns
Name Type Description
SelectQuery A new SelectQuery object
update
t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Table.update(values)

Create an UPDATE query for this table.

Parameters
Name Type Description Default
values dict of str to Any Column-value pairs to set in the UPDATE required
Returns
Name Type Description
UpdateQuery A new UpdateQuery object

mrm_BridgeOpeningTableColumns

tables.auto_generated.mrm_BridgeOpening.mrm_BridgeOpeningTableColumns(table)

Column names for mrm_BridgeOpening (mrm_BridgeOpening).

Attributes

Name Description
ArchesNum Number of arches
AsymmetryChk Include asymmetric opening
ContractionLoss Contraction loss coef. [()]
CustomTableBase Custom table
CustomTableBaseR Custom table
CustomTableEntran Custom table
CustomTableEntranR Custom table
CustromTableAbut Custom table
CustromTableAbutR Custom table
CustromTableDepth Custom table
CustromTableDepthR Custom table
CustromTableFroude Custom table
CustromTableFroudeR Custom table
CustromTableVel Custom table
CustromTableWW Custom table
CustromTableWWR Custom table
DatumDownCrs Datum [m]
DatumUpCrs Datum [m]
DownCrsSlope Slope [()]
DownCrsTypeNo Cross section
EctrCustomTable Custom table
EctrUseCustomNo Use custom table
EmbankSlope Slope
EmbankSlopeR Slope
EntranAngle Angle [deg]
EntranAngleR Angle [deg]
EntranRadius Radius [m]
EntranRadiusR Radius [m]
EntranTypeNo Type
EntranTypeRNo Type
EntranWidth Width [m]
EntranWidthR Width [m]
ExpansionLoss Expansion loss coef. [()]
FromSDown From S value [m]
FromSUp From S value [m]
IncludeEctrNo Include eccentricity
IncludePirNo Include piers / piles
IncludeSknNo Include skewness
IncludeSpdNo Include spur dykes
LevelBottom Level of bottom of arch curvature [m]
LevelOfLength Level of waterway length [m]
LevelOfLengthR Level of waterway length [m]
LevelTop Level of top of arch curvature [m]
MUID ID
Method Method
OffsetDSSection Horizontal offset for downstream bridge section [m]
OffsetOver Horizontal offset for overflow level [m]
OffsetSub Horizontal offset for submergence level [m]
OffsetUSSection Horizontal offset for upstream bridge section [m]
OflDeckLevel Bridge deck level [m]
OflDischargeCoef1 Discharge coef #1
OflDischargeCoef2 Discharge coef #2
OflLength Length [m]
OflMethodNo Method
OflSurfaceNo Surface
OflUseCustomTableNo Use custom table
OflWeirID Weir
OpeningTypeNo Opening type
OpeningTypeRNo Opening type, right
OpeningWidth Opening width [m]
PileCustomTable1L Custom table
PileCustomTable2L Custom table
PirCustomTable Custom table
PirTypeNo Type
PirUseCustomNo Use custom table
PirWWBlock Waterway blocked [()]
RadioType Ratio
Radius Radius of arch curvature [m]
RiverBridgeID River bridge ID
RoughTypeNo Roughness type
RoughValue Roughness value
SknAngle Angle [deg]
SknCustomTable Custom table
SknUseCustomNo Use custom table
SpdAngle Angle [deg]
SpdAngleR Angle [deg]
SpdCustomTable1 Table 1
SpdCustomTable2 Table 1
SpdCustomTableR1 Table 2
SpdCustomTableR2 Table 2
SpdLength Length [m]
SpdLengthR Length [m]
SpdOffset Offset [m]
SpdOffsetR Offset [m]
SpdTypeNo Type
SpdTypeRNo Type
SpdUseCustom Use custom table
SpdUseCustomR Use custom tables, right
Sqn Sqn
SubMgcContraction Contraction loss [()]
SubMgcCulvertID Culvert
SubMgcCustomTable Custom table
SubMgcDischargeCoef Discharge coef. [()]
SubMgcExpansion Expansion loss [()]
SubMgcFactor Submergence factor
SubMgcMethodNo Method
SubMgcSoffitLevel Bridge soffit level [m]
SubMgcUseCustomTableNo Use custom table
SubmergenceTypeNo Include
TableCrsDownID Custom table
TableCrsUpID Custom table
ToSDown To S value [m]
ToSUp To S value [m]
TypeBaseNo Type
UseCustomBaseNo Use custom table
UseCustomBaseRNo Use custom table
UseCustomEntranNo Use custom table
UseCustomEntranRNo Use custom table
UseCustromAbutNo Use custom table
UseCustromAbutRNo Use custom table
UseCustromCrsDownNo Use custom sub-cross section
UseCustromCrsUpNo Use custom sub-cross section
UseCustromDepthNo Use custom table
UseCustromDepthRNo Use custom table
UseCustromFroudeNo Use custom table
UseCustromFroudeRNo Use custom table
UseCustromVelNo Use custom table
UseCustromWWNo Use custom table
UseCustromWWRNo Use custom table
WWAngle Angle [deg]
WWAngleR Angle [deg]
WaterwayLength Waterway length [m]
WaterwayLengthR Waterway length [m]